- The distance between Trout Lake, Ontario, Canada and Seattle/ Tacoma, Wa, Usa is approximately 2,371 km or 1,473 mi.
- To reach Trout Lake, Ontario in this distance one would set out from Seattle/ Tacoma, Wa bearing 60.5°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Trout Lake, Ontario bearing 85.9° or E .
- Trout Lake, Ontario has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c) whereas Seattle/ Tacoma, Wa has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b).
- Trout Lake, Ontario is in or near the boreal wet forest biome whereas Seattle/ Tacoma, Wa is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 14.1 °C (25.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 25.9 °C (46.6°F) more in Trout Lake, Ontario.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 333.7 mm (13.1 in) less which is equivalent to 333.7 l/m² (8.19 US gal/ft²) or 3,337,000 l/ha (356,747 US gal/ac) less. About 2/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 6.4° lower in Trout Lake, Ontario than in Seattle/ Tacoma, Wa.
